The Israel Defense Forces (IDF) announced that in a targeted airstrike five armed terrorists were killed near a vehicle bearing the emblem of the international humanitarian aid organization World Central Kitchen (WCK).
According to the military, WCK itself confirmed that it had no connection to the vehicle or the individuals, and that these individuals posed a threat to Israeli troops.
Israeli soldiers in GazaThe IDF indicated that the combatants "deliberately placed the emblem and wore yellow vests in an attempt to conceal their activity and avoid being targeted, cynically exploiting the status and trust enjoyed by humanitarian aid organizations."
The vehicle was located in the Deir al-Balah area. An Israeli Air Force fighter jet attacked it, eliminating the five suspects.
The Coordinator of Government Activities in the Territories (COGAT) confirmed that WCK was not linked to the operation of the vehicle. "Hamas and other terrorist organizations exploit the humanitarian effort to advance terrorist objectives at the expense of the well-being of the population in Gaza," the statement noted, adding that Israel will continue to cooperate with international NGOs to prevent this type of abuse.
